I have a FreeBSD 4.3 IPFilter 3.4.17 based firewall/gateway system at home that uses an on-demand PPP connection to my ISP via Hayes type 56k modem. I would like to be able to call via telephone my home number from a remote location and have getty/mgetty? then start a PPP connection to my ISP after detecting the "RING" so I can SSH into my home system. Searching the web finds lots of PPP info, but I have been unable to locate this situation.
